If you go on lloyds bank website the number is there with info. The number is 0800 151 0292. If you don't have any paperwork then they will have the loan account number and will be able to tell you straight away if you had PPI. If you did then they will go through the forms with you. I was given £1,615.40 with tax deducted for each of my three loans I or they had no idea of loan amount. It was based on average payout they are currently issuing.
Twenty mins on the phone wait 8weeks for an answer.
